ELECTROCHEMICAL SENSOR HAVING A MEDIATOR COMPOUND

Abstract
An electrochemical sensor, especially for gases, is provided having a mediator compound based on transition metal salts of polybasic acids and/or transition metal salts of polyhydroxycarboxylic acids. The electrochemical sensor also contains a DLC, BDD or a precious metal thin-layer measuring electrode (3). The electrochemical sensor may be used for determining SO2 and H2S.

Claims
  • 1. An electrochemical gas sensor for detecting an analyte, the electrochemical gas sensor comprising: a measuring electrode;an auxiliary electrode;an electrolyte solution containing the mediator compound, said mediator compound comprising a transition metal salt of an acid compound, said acid compound containing one of at least two acid groups or at least one hydroxyl group and at least one acid group.
  • 2. An electrochemical gas sensor in accordance with claim 1, wherein said acid compound is a carboxylic acid.
  • 3. An electrochemical gas sensor in accordance with claim 1, wherein the carboxylic acid is an aromatic carboxylic acid with two or three carboxyl groups.
  • 4. An electrochemical gas sensor in accordance with claim 1, wherein the carboxylic acid is phthalic acid, isophthalic acid or terephthalic acid.
  • 5. An electrochemical gas sensor in accordance with at least claim 1, wherein the acid compound is an aliphatic polycarboxylic acid.
  • 6. An electrochemical gas sensor in accordance with at least claim 1, wherein the acid compound is citric acid.
  • 7. An electrochemical gas sensor in accordance with claim 1, wherein the acid compound is gluconic acid.
  • 8. An electrochemical gas sensor in accordance with claim 1, wherein the acid compound is a boric acid.
  • 9. An electrochemical gas sensor in accordance with claim 1, wherein the electrolyte solution contains alkali or alkaline earth metal salts.
  • 10. An electrochemical gas sensor in accordance with claim 1, wherein the electrolyte solution contains LiCl.
  • 11. An electrochemical gas sensor in accordance with at least claim 1, wherein water or organic solvents are used as a solvent.
  • 12. An electrochemical gas sensor in accordance with at least claim 1, wherein ethylene and/or propylene carbonate are used as a solvent.
  • 13. An electrochemical gas sensor in accordance with at least claim 1, wherein the measuring electrode is a diamond-like carbon, boron-doped diamond, a precious metal thin-layer electrode or carbon nanotubes.
  • 14. An electrochemical gas sensor in accordance with claim 9, wherein the thickness of the precious metal thin-layer electrode is 100-500 nm.
  • 15. An electrochemical gas sensor in accordance with at least claim 1, wherein the transition metal salt is a copper salt or a Cu2+ salt.
  • 16. An electrochemical gas sensor in accordance with claim 11, wherein the Cu2+ salt is CuCl2 and the concentration of CuCl2 in a 2-10-molar LiCl solution is between 0.2 mol and 1.0 mol.
  • 17. An electrochemical gas sensor in accordance with claim 11, wherein the Cu2+, salt is CuCl2 and the concentration of CuCl2 in a 2-10-molar LiCl solution is about 0.5 mol.
  • 18. An electrochemical gas sensor in accordance with claim 1, wherein the transition metal salt is an iron salt or an Fe3+ salt.
  • 19. An electrochemical gas sensor in accordance with claim 1, further comprising a gas-permeable membrane, said housing having an opening with said gas-permeable membrane wherein the analyte substance enters the area of said measuring electrode via said gas-permeable membrane.
  • 20. An electrochemical gas sensor in accordance with claim 1, further comprising a reference electrode.
  • 21. An electrochemical gas sensor in accordance with claim 1, further comprising a protective electrode arranged behind said measuring electrode.
  • 22. A method of electrochemical gas sensing for detecting an analyte, the method comprising: providing a measuring electrode;providing an auxiliary electrode;providing an electrolyte solution containing the mediator compound, said mediator compound comprising a transition metal salt of an acid compound, said acid compound containing one of at least two acid groups or at least one hydroxyl group and at least one acid group;positioning said measuring electrode and said auxiliary electrode in said electrolyte solution containing the mediator compound to provide an electrochemical gas sensor.
  • 23. A method according to claim 22, further comprising: using the electrochemical gas sensor for determining SO2 concentration in a gas wherein said electrolyte is or contains a chloride.
  • 24. A method according to claim 22, further comprising: using the electrochemical gas sensor for determining H2S concentration in a gas wherein said electrolyte is or contains a chloride.
